Broadcom BCM55538B0KFSBG: Advanced Ethernet Switch Solution for High-Performance Networking

The exponential growth in data traffic, driven by cloud computing, IoT proliferation, and high-bandwidth applications, demands networking infrastructure that is both robust and intelligent. At the heart of this modern connectivity lies the advanced Ethernet switch, a critical component for directing data flows efficiently and reliably. The Broadcom BCM55538B0KFSBG represents a pinnacle of this technology, engineered to meet the stringent demands of next-generation enterprise, data center, and service provider networks.

This highly integrated switch solution is built upon a sophisticated architecture that delivers exceptional port density and scalability. It supports a high number of Gigabit Ethernet and multi-gigabit ports, enabling seamless aggregation of traffic from numerous endpoints. This is crucial for building out expansive network backbones that must handle massive concurrent data streams without becoming a bottleneck. The device’s non-blocking switching fabric ensures wire-speed performance across all ports, guaranteeing that latency is minimized even under maximum load, a vital requirement for real-time applications like video conferencing and financial trading.

Beyond raw throughput, the BCM55538B0KFSBG excels in its advanced feature set and programmability. It incorporates robust Quality of Service (QoS) mechanisms, allowing network administrators to prioritize critical traffic, ensuring optimal performance for mission-critical applications. Features like fine-grained traffic management and comprehensive access control lists (ACLs) provide the tools necessary for implementing complex security and routing policies directly in hardware. Furthermore, its support for the latest software-defined networking (SDN) protocols offers unparalleled flexibility, enabling automated provisioning, dynamic traffic engineering, and centralized network management.

Power efficiency is another cornerstone of its design. Leveraging cutting-edge silicon process technology, the switch chip optimizes power consumption without compromising performance. This leads to a significantly lower total cost of ownership (TCO) by reducing operational expenses associated with cooling and electricity, which is a major consideration for large-scale data center deployments.

In essence, the Broadcom BCM55538B0KFSBG is more than just a switch; it is a comprehensive networking platform designed to future-proof infrastructure. It provides the high availability and resilience needed for 24/7 operations, featuring advanced diagnostics and monitoring capabilities that facilitate proactive maintenance and swift troubleshooting.
